Stepping towards integrating robotics into law enforcement, Chinese authorities have begun testing an autonomous spherical robot, the RT-G, developed by the local robotics company Logon Technology. This high-tech robot is designed to operate in both extreme environments and urban settings, offering a glimpse into the future of crime prevention.

The RT-G is an impressive piece of technology, capable of navigating across land and water at speeds of up to 35 km/h, according to Interesting Engineering. Its spherical design allows it to smoothly roll over various terrains, including mud and rough surfaces, making it versatile in all environments. The robot is also built to withstand harsh conditions, with the ability to endure impacts of up to four tons, ensuring that it can operate effectively in high-risk situations.

The most notable feature of the RT-G is its advanced AI, which enables it to assist law enforcement in urban patrols. According to The Sun, the robot is equipped with facial recognition technology, allowing it to identify known criminals and detect disturbances. Once a threat is identified, RT-G can take action on its own. Equipped with non-lethal tools such as a net gun, tear gas sprayers, and sound-wave dispersal devices, it can immobilize suspects without escalating the situation.

Since its debut just two months ago, videos have shown the robot patrolling city streets, chasing and immobilizing suspects, and collaborating with police officers to maintain public safety. According to Interesting Engineering, Initially, some viewed the RT-G as a mere marketing gimmick, but its rapid deployment highlights the increasing integration of AI-driven robots in real-world policing operations.

Logon Technology’s RT-G is a significant advancement in law enforcement technology, making police officer’s job more efficient by delegating patrol work to autonomous robotic forces, which could also assist safety in crime prevention. As this technology continues to evolve, it could represent a new era of robotic policing, where AI-driven tools work alongside traditional methods.
